cpumask: fix checking valid cpu range
The range of valid CPUs is [0, nr_cpu_ids). Some cpumask functions are passed with a shifted CPU index, and for them, the valid range is [-1, nr_cpu_ids-1). Currently for those functions, we check the index against [-1, nr_cpu_ids), which is wrong. Signed-off-by: Yury Norov <yury.norov@gmail.com>
